### 1. **Cancellation Policy**
– **Client-Initiated Cancellation**:
– You may cancel your website development project at any time by providing written notice to **Patnahost**.
– If cancellation occurs after work has started, you will be responsible for paying for the work completed up to the point of cancellation, including any non-refundable deposit (if applicable).
– Any cancellation request made after the final delivery or completion of the project will not be eligible for a refund.
– **Patnahost-Initiated Cancellation**:
– Patnahost reserves the right to cancel the project if the Client fails to provide necessary information, approvals, or payments as required in the agreement.
– In such cases, you will be responsible for any completed work, and any outstanding balances will be due immediately.
### 2. **Refund Policy**
– **Refund Eligibility**:
– Refunds may be issued only under the following circumstances:
– If no work has been started or if you cancel before any development work begins, you are eligible for a full refund of any advance payments made.
– If you cancel after work has started, refunds will be issued for the unused portion of the payment, if applicable. Refunds will be calculated based on the work completed and the time spent on the project.
– In cases of technical errors or issues that cannot be resolved, a partial or full refund may be considered based on the extent of the issue.
– **Non-Refundable Services**:
– Deposits for custom work, design, or any other services rendered are typically non-refundable once work has started.
– If you have purchased third-party software, themes, or other licensed services through us, these payments are non-refundable as we do not have control over third-party vendor refund policies.

### 3. **Late Payments and Delays**
– **Client Delays**: If the Client delays providing necessary content, approvals, or feedback, project timelines may be extended, and additional charges may apply. However, no refunds will be provided due to delays caused by the Client.
– **Patnahost Delays**: If **Patnahost** is responsible for delays in project completion beyond the agreed-upon timeline, we will work with the Client to resolve the issue. In such cases, partial refunds or additional work may be offered as a goodwill gesture, but this will be assessed on a case-by-case basis.
### 4. **Scope of Work Modifications**
– If you wish to make changes to the scope of work after the project has started, additional charges may apply. These changes should be communicated in writing and agreed upon by both parties. Adjustments will be reflected in an updated project agreement and timeline.

### 6. **Exceptions**
– No refunds will be issued after the final delivery of the project, and any dissatisfaction after the completion of work must be addressed within the warranty period, if applicable.
– Once the website has been launched and the Client has approved the final version, no further refunds will be provided unless specified otherwise in the agreement.
### 7. **Dispute Resolution**
In case of any disputes or disagreements related to the refund or cancellation process, both parties agree to attempt resolution through negotiation. If the dispute cannot be resolved amicably, it may be taken to mediation or arbitration, as outlined in the project contract.
